Unlocking Microsoft SCCM 2012 R2 Objects
When you will edit a Task Sequenz or other entries in Microsoft System Center Configuration Manager 2012 R2 and the message "Cannot edit the object, which is in use by 'username' at Site 'configmgr site'." pop up, you can fix this with the following steps.
- Open Microsoft SQL Server with the SCCM instance
- Make a SQL Query with the following statement
- select * from SEDO_LockState where LockStateID <> 0
- Copy the LockID from the entrie you will unlock
- Make a second SQL query with the following statement
- DELETE from SEDO_LockState where LockID = '<copied LockID from the previous query>'
